The Track Monster: Ather 450 Apex / 450X When it comes to true "sporty" handling and sophisticated engineering, Ather remains the king of the twisties. While the **450X** is the benchmark for enthusiast handling, the **450 Apex** takes it to an extreme level. * **Top Speed:** 100 km/h (450 Apex) / 90 km/h (450X) * **0-40 km/h:** 2.9 seconds (450 Apex) * **Why it’s sporty:** It features a lightweight, trellis-frame aluminum chassis that gives it the sharpest, most motorcycle-like handling on this list. It also includes features like **"Warp+"** (or Wrap mode on Apex) and **"Magic Twist"** (negative throttle regeneration for aggressive braking). --- ## 2. The Spec King: Ola S1 Pro (Gen 2 / Gen 3) If your definition of sporty is raw, straight-line speed and blistering acceleration to leave traffic trailing behind, the Ola S1 Pro dominates the numbers game. * **Top Speed:** 120 km/h to 141 km/h (depending on the exact software package/variant) * **0-40 km/h:** A blistering 2.0 to 2.1 seconds in **Hyper Mode**. * **Why it’s sporty:** It packs a massive peak power output (up to 13–16 kW on high-performance variants). The Gen 2/3 architecture utilizes a lighter hybrid chassis and a conventional telescopic front fork which vastly improved its high-speed stability and front-end feedback over the original Gen 1 model. --- ## 3. The Powerhouse Outsider: Simple One (Gen 2) Simple Energy’s flagship has been a performance enthusiast's darling on paper, boasting massive battery setups and heavy motor outputs. * **Top Speed:** 115 km/h * **0-40 km/h:** 2.55 seconds * **Why it’s sporty:** It offers **8.8 kW of peak motor power** and aggressive torque delivery. It has custom performance maps and multi-level regenerative braking, delivering a punchy, athletic ride, though its availability can be regional compared to Ola or Ather. --- ## Quick Comparison Table | Feature | Ather 450 Apex / 450X | Ola S1 Pro | Simple One (Gen 2) | |:--- |:--- |:--- |:--- | | **Sporty Persona** | Handling & Cornering Precision | Straight-line Acceleration & Top Speed | Balanced Raw Power & Range | | **Top Speed** | 90 - 100 km/h | 120 - 141 km/h | 115 km/h | | **0-40 km/h** | ~2.9 secs | ~2.0 secs | 2.55 secs | | **Peak Power** | 6.4 kW - 7 kW | 11 kW - 16 kW | 8.8 kW | > **Verdict:** Go for the **Ather 450 Apex/450X** if you want a machine that feels like a razor-sharp sports bike in corners. Go for the **Ola S1 Pro** if you want to win stoplight drag races and want the highest top speed on open stretches.
